My engine starts fine cold. It cranks over very well. It barely cranks when hot. If I let it cool down past say 150 degrees, it cranks again. The starter is newly rebuilt be a reputable marine dealer. A couple years ago it started fine cold or hot, so I am thinking that it is the connections. I only used it a couple times these past few years. However, I am wondering what the engine would be harder to crank when hot. That doesn?t make any sense to me at all. Any thoughts?

Always check the simplest explanation first, and you are thinking in the right (especially if the boat has been sitting) direction. Clean and tighten all of your connections, especially battery, starter and ground connections. See if that helps and work from there.

Does it seem like it is trying to start (fuel problem) or does it seem like there is no fire to the plugs (electrical). If electrical, then after checking all the connections, I would check the coil....
